While the previously mentioned artists are present-day, Albert Bierstadt was an artist whose art could best be defined as inspiring art work. Because bierstadt's works aren't pointedly religiously based, his landscapes exalt all of God's creations. They illustrate the
diginity of nature in various forms from exquisite daybreaks to glorious waterfalls to brilliant mountain ranges in a type that is very detailed and often excentuated by light.
Although he was born in Germany in the 19th century, Bierstadt's family came to america when when he was a toddler. He was renowned for his pieces that represented the splendor of the Old American West, and once, his works were costly. Sadly, his form of art eventually went out of favor, and he went bankrupt later in his life. Today, his paintings are honored by both religious and non spiritual collectors, which are prominently presented in a Christian art gallery.
